diff options
Diffstat (limited to 'pw_tokenizer/token_database.cc')
-rw-r--r-- | pw_tokenizer/token_database.cc |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/pw_tokenizer/token_database.cc b/pw_tokenizer/token_database.cc index 42c145b67..7ab5d6b28 100644 --- a/pw_tokenizer/token_database.cc +++ b/pw_tokenizer/token_database.cc @@ -17,20 +17,20 @@ namespace pw::tokenizer { TokenDatabase::Entry TokenDatabase::Entries::operator[](size_t index) const { - Iterator it = begin(); + iterator it = begin(); for (size_t i = 0; i < index; ++i) { ++it; } - return it.entry(); + return *it; } TokenDatabase::Entries TokenDatabase::Find(const uint32_t token) const { - Iterator first = begin(); + iterator first = begin(); while (first != end() && token > first->token) { ++first; } - Iterator last = first; + iterator last = first; while (last != end() && token == last->token) { ++last; } |